Is an Air Source Heat Pump Better Than a Standard AC Unit in Plymouth?
Detroit winters hit hard and summers bring sticky humidity. If you live in Plymouth Michigan you are deciding between a standard central air conditioner and a modern air source heat pump. The short answer is this: a heat pump wins for year-round comfort and lower utility bills but only if you choose a cold climate model with a gas furnace backup. For most Plymouth homeowners the hybrid dual fuel setup delivers the best balance of efficiency and reliability. How a Heat Pump Differs From a Standard AC
A central air conditioner only moves heat out of your home in summer. A heat pump does that too but also reverses the process in winter to pull heat from the outside air and bring it inside. The key component is the reversing valve which allows the refrigerant flow to change direction. In summer both systems cool using the same compressor and coils. Performance in Michigan Winters: The Cold Climate Factor
Traditional heat pumps lose efficiency when outdoor temperatures drop below 25°F. In Plymouth that means you would rely heavily on expensive electric resistance backup heat during most winter nights. Cold climate heat pumps (ccASHP) use variable speed compressors and advanced refrigerants to extract usable heat even when it is -10°F outside. The U.S. Department of Energy defines a cold climate heat pump as one that maintains at least 70 percent of its rated heating capacity at 5°F and continues operating down to -15°F. Plymouth sits in climate zone 5 where the 99 percent design temperature is -1°F according to the International Energy Conservation Code. That means your heating equipment must handle at least one full day per year at that extreme. A standard heat pump would struggle while a ccASHP paired with a high-efficiency gas furnace can automatically switch to gas when electric heat becomes inefficient. Cost Comparison: Installation vs Monthly Utilities in Detroit
Upfront installation for a cold climate heat pump system with a gas furnace backup runs about $2,000 to $4,000 more than a standard AC plus furnace. That premium pays off in two ways. First, heat pumps earn a federal tax credit of up to $2,000 under the Inflation Reduction Act 25C provision for qualifying high-efficiency equipment. Second, Michigan electricity rates average 16.7 cents per kilowatt-hour while natural gas costs about $1.20 per therm. A heat pump can deliver three times more heat per unit of electricity than a resistance heater, cutting heating costs by 30 to 50 percent compared to electric backup alone. Using current DTE Energy and Consumers Energy rates a Plymouth homeowner with a 2,000 square foot home could save $400 to $600 per year on heating compared to a standard AC and electric furnace. Michigan Rebates and Tax Credits (DTE, Consumers Energy & IRA)
Both DTE Energy and Consumers Energy offer rebates for qualifying heat pumps. DTE provides up to $3,000 for a cold climate heat pump with a minimum heating seasonal performance factor (HSPF2) of 8.2. Consumers Energy offers up to $2,000 for the same equipment. These rebates apply only to ccASHP models that meet the cold climate standard. You must work with a participating contractor and submit the rebate application within 90 days of installation.
The federal 25C tax credit covers 30 percent of the installed cost up to $2,000 for qualifying heat pumps. The credit applies to both the equipment and installation labor. You claim it on your federal tax return for the year the system is placed in service. Combining local rebates with the federal credit can reduce your net investment by $4,000 to $5,000.. Lifespan and Maintenance Requirements
A quality air source heat pump lasts 12 to 15 years with proper maintenance. The compressor and reversing valve are the most critical components. Annual professional tune-ups should include checking refrigerant charge, testing capacitor health, and cleaning the outdoor coil. Heat pumps run year-round so the outdoor unit faces more wear than a seasonal AC. The gas furnace backup in a dual fuel system typically lasts 15 to 20 years because it only operates during the coldest months. Standard AC units with gas furnaces also last 15 to 20 years but only run in summer. That reduced runtime can mean slightly lower maintenance costs over the life of the system. Both setups require monthly air filter changes and periodic duct cleaning to maintain efficiency.. Environmental Impact in Michigan
Michigan generates about 32 percent of its electricity from renewable sources with the rest coming from natural gas, coal, and nuclear. A heat pump uses electricity more efficiently than resistance heat so even on a mixed grid it produces fewer greenhouse gas emissions per unit of heat than a gas furnace. The exact reduction depends on your utility’s fuel mix and your home’s insulation level. In Plymouth where DTE Energy is the primary provider the carbon intensity of electricity is dropping each year as coal plants retire.
Pairing a heat pump with a high-efficiency gas furnace creates a system that automatically uses the cleanest fuel available at any given outdoor temperature. Common Concerns and Misconceptions
Some homeowners worry that a heat pump will blow cold air in winter. Modern variable speed units actually modulate their output to match the home’s heat loss, so supply air stays warm even in freezing conditions. Another myth is that heat pumps are noisy. New ccASHP models operate at 50 to 60 decibels from 10 feet away, about the same as a modern refrigerator.
People also think heat pumps cannot handle Michigan humidity. In fact, the same refrigeration cycle that cools in summer also dehumidifies. A heat pump removes moisture from indoor air just like an AC, and many models include a dedicated dehumidification mode for spring and fall when cooling is not needed but humidity is high. Why Dual Fuel is the Michigan Gold Standard
Dual fuel systems automatically switch between electric heat pump and gas furnace based on outdoor temperature and utility rates. Most systems switch to gas when the temperature drops below 30°F or when the heat pump cannot meet the thermostat setpoint within 10 minutes. This protects you from the high cost of electric resistance backup while still capturing the efficiency of the heat pump during milder weather.
In Plymouth where January lows average 18°F and record lows reach -20°F the hybrid setup ensures you never lose heat. The only way to know which system is right for your home is a detailed Manual J load calculation. This analysis measures your home’s heat loss and gain based on square footage, insulation levels, window types, and local climate data. Guessing at equipment size leads to short cycling, high bills, and premature failure. Frequently Asked Questions
Do heat pumps work in Michigan winters?
Yes, but only if you choose a cold climate model. Standard heat pumps lose efficiency below 25°F while ccASHP units are engineered to operate down to -15°F and maintain most of their heating capacity at 5°F.
How much can I save with a heat pump in Plymouth?

What rebates are available for heat pumps in Michigan?
DTE Energy offers up to $3,000 and Consumers Energy offers up to $2,000 for qualifying cold climate heat pumps. The federal 25C tax credit adds up to $2,000 more. All require installation by a participating contractor.
Is a heat pump louder than a standard AC?
No. Modern cold climate heat pumps operate at 50 to 60 decibels from 10 feet away, similar to a modern refrigerator. Proper installation on a vibration isolator pad further reduces noise.
How long does a heat pump last in Michigan?
With annual maintenance a quality heat pump lasts 12 to 15 years. The compressor and reversing valve are the most critical components. Pairing it with a gas furnace for extreme cold extends overall system reliability.
Can I keep my existing furnace and just add a heat pump?
Yes. This is the most common hybrid setup. The heat pump handles heating and cooling while the furnace acts as backup for the coldest days.
